Job Overview
Critical Path Advisors, a leading non-profit consulting firm specializing in strategic advisory services for mission-driven organizations, is seeking a highly organized and proactive Executive Assistant to support our executive leadership team. Based in the heart of New York, NY, this role is pivotal in ensuring seamless operations, allowing our leaders to focus on delivering impactful solutions to clients in education, healthcare, and social impact sectors. As a key team member, you will thrive in a dynamic, collaborative environment dedicated to advancing non-profit missions through expert guidance and innovation.
Key Responsibilities
The Executive Assistant will manage complex executive calendars, coordinating meetings, travel arrangements, and events with precision and discretion. You will serve as the primary point of contact for internal and external stakeholders, handling communications, preparing detailed reports, presentations, and briefing materials. Additional duties include overseeing office logistics, tracking project timelines, assisting with board preparations, expense management, and supporting special initiatives to enhance organizational efficiency. Your role will also involve conducting research, drafting correspondence, and maintaining confidential records to support strategic decision-making.
Required Qualifications
A bachelor's degree in business administration, communications, or a related field is required, along with at least 3-5 years of executive support experience, preferably in non-profit or consulting environments. Proven 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ced setting is essential, with strong pro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, Google Workspace, and virtual meeting platforms like Zoom or Teams. Experience in New York City's non-profit sector is a plus.
Skills
Exceptional organizational and time-management skills are critical, paired with superior written and verbal communication abilities. You must demonstrate discretion with sensitive information, advanced problem-solving capabilities, and tech-savviness for tools like project management software (e.g., Asana, Trello). Emotional intelligence, adaptability, and a passion for non-profit work will set you apart, along with keen attention to detail and proactive anticipation of executive needs.
